Colonel John Corry (1712 – 1740 or 1741) was an Irish politician.
The son of Colonel John Corry and Sarah Leslie, he was High Sheriff of Fermanagh in 1737. Corry served in the Fermanagh Militia reaching the rank of Colonel. From 1739 to 1741, he was Member of Parliament for Killybegs. Corry died unmarried and childless.
